Boeing 777-200ER British Airways

Registration: G-VIIG
Type: 777-236ER
Engines: 2 × GE GE90-85B
Serial Number: 27489
First flight: Mar 31, 1997

British Airways is the flag carrier airline of the United Kingdom and the largest airline in the United Kingdom. The airline is based in Waterside near its main hub at London Heathrow Airport. A British Airways Board was established by the United Kingdom government in 1972 to manage the two nationalised airline corporations, British Overseas Airways Corporation and British European Airways, and two smaller Cambrian Airways, and Northeast Airlines. On 31 March 1974, all four companies were merged to form British Airways. The centrepiece of the airline's long-haul fleet is the Boeing 777. British Airways is a founding member of the Oneworld airline alliance.
